New Tool Released to Measure ROI for Upcoming CUNA CFO Council Conference
Credit union finance professionals can now calculate their specific return on investment for attending the 15th annual CUNA CFO Council Conference and Roundtable, May 17-20, in Las Vegas. The CUNA CFO Council has just released a “Conference ROI Calculator” spreadsheet on their website. “The conference is not an expense, but an investment in your credit union's future,” says Peg Lamb, council treasurer and senior vice president of finance for DFCU Financial CU in Dearborn, Michigan. “The networking alone is one of the best reasons to attend. However, we also present educational sessions that not only teach new concepts and ideas but offer take-aways to attendees that can be immediately implemented upon return.” Individuals can input expenses into the calculator, check all of the boxes of interest, and go to the bottom of the spreadsheet to find the ROI. “These are hard facts just waiting to be shared with your CEO about attending the conference,” says Lamb.
